Luca Andrea Cardelli , miembro de la Royal Society (FRS), es un informático italiano que es profesor de investigación en la Universidad de Oxford en Oxford , Reino Unido. [1] [5] Cardelli es bien conocido por su investigación en teoría de tipos y semántica operativa . [6] [7] Entre otras contribuciones, en lenguajes de programación , ayudó a diseñar el lenguaje Modula-3 , implementó el primer compilador para el lenguaje funcional (no puro) ML , definió el concepto deprogramación tipográfica , y ayudó a desarrollar el lenguaje experimental Polyphonic C # . [2] [8] [9] [10] [11] [12]
Luca Cardelli | |
---|---|
![]() | |
Nació | Luca Andrea Cardelli |
Educación | Universidad de Pisa [1] Doctorado, Universidad de Edimburgo , 1982 |
Conocido por | Teoría de los objetos [2] con Martín Abadi |
Premios | Miembro de la Royal Society (2005) Premio Dahl-Nygaard (2007) Miembro de la ACM (2005) |
Carrera científica | |
Campos | Teoría de tipos Semántica operacional |
Instituciones | Bell Labs Microsoft Research Digital Equipment Corporation Universidad de Edimburgo Universidad de Oxford [3] |
Tesis | Un enfoque algebraico para la descripción y verificación de hardware (1982) |
Asesor de doctorado | Gordon Plotkin [4] |
Sitio web | lucacardelli |
Educación
Nació en Montecatini Terme , Italia . Asistió a la Universidad de Pisa [1] antes de recibir su Doctorado en Filosofía (PhD) de la Universidad de Edimburgo en 1982. [13] Antes de unirse a la Universidad de Oxford en 2014, y a Microsoft Research en Cambridge , Reino Unido en 1997, trabajó para Bell Labs y Digital Equipment Corporation , [1] y contribuyó al software Unix , incluido vismon . [14]
Premios
En 2004 fue admitido como miembro de la Association for Computing Machinery . Es miembro de la Royal Society . En 2007, Cardelli recibió el premio Senior AITO Dahl – Nygaard, que lleva el nombre de Ole-Johan Dahl y Kristen Nygaard . [15]
Referencias
- ^ a b c d "Cardelli, Luca" . Quién es quién 2013, A & C Black, una impresión de Bloomsbury Publishing plc, 2013; edn en línea, Oxford University Press .(requiere suscripción)
- ^ a b Cardelli, Luca; Abadi, Martín (1996). Una teoría de los objetos . Berlín: Springer. ISBN 978-0-387-94775-4.
- ^ Cardelli, Luca (2021). "Luca Cardelli" . Departamento de Ciencias de la Computación . Universidad de Oxford.
- ^ Luca Cardelli en el Proyecto de genealogía matemática
- ^ Dalchau, N .; Phillips, A .; Goldstein, LD; Howarth, M .; Cardelli, L .; Emmott, S .; Elliott, T .; Werner, JM (2011). Chakraborty, Arup K (ed.). "Una relación de filtrado de péptidos cuantifica la optimización de péptidos de clase I de MHC" . PLOS Biología Computacional . 7 (10): e1002144. Código Bibliográfico : 2011PLSCB ... 7E2144D . doi : 10.1371 / journal.pcbi.1002144 . PMC 3195949 . PMID 22022238 .
- ^ Cardelli, L. (1996). "Las malas propiedades de ingeniería de los lenguajes orientados a objetos" . Encuestas de computación ACM . 28 (4es): 150 – es. doi : 10.1145 / 242224.242415 . S2CID 12105785 .
- ^ Cardelli, Luca; Wegner, Peter (diciembre de 1985). "Sobre la comprensión de los tipos, la abstracción de datos y el polimorfismo" (PDF) . Encuestas de computación ACM . 17 (4): 471–523. CiteSeerX 10.1.1.117.695 . doi : 10.1145 / 6041.6042 . ISSN 0360-0300 . S2CID 2921816 .
- ^ Página de perfil del autor de Luca Cardelli en laBiblioteca digital de ACM
- ^ Luca Cardelli en elservidor de bibliografía DBLP
- ^ Lista de publicaciones de Microsoft Academic
- ^ Publicaciones de Luca Cardelli indexadas por labase de datos bibliográfica Scopus . (requiere suscripción)
- ^ Abadi, M .; Cardelli, L .; Curien, PL; Levy, JJ (1990). "Sustituciones explícitas". Actas del 17º simposio ACM SIGPLAN-SIGACT sobre Principios de lenguajes de programación (POPL) '90 . pag. 31–46. CiteSeerX 10.1.1.22.9903 . doi : 10.1145 / 96709.96712 . ISBN 978-0897913430. S2CID 7265577 .
- ^ Cardelli, Luca (1982). Un enfoque algebraico para la descripción y verificación de hardware (tesis doctoral). Universidad de Edimburgo.
- ^ McIlroy, MD (1987). Un lector de investigación Unix: extractos comentados del Manual del programador, 1971–1986 (PDF) (Informe técnico). CSTR. Bell Labs. 139.
- ^ "Los ganadores del premio AITO Dahl – Nygaard de 2007" . Association Internationale pour les Technologies Objets . Informática Mjølner. 2007.
enlaces externos
- Página web oficial
- Entrevista Computerworld con Luca Cardelli